Plants, algae, and a group of bacteria called cyanobacteria are the only organisms capable of performing photosynthesis (figure \(\pageindex{1}\)). Photosynthesis is the process used by plants, algae and some bacteria to turn sunlight into energy. During photosynthesis, plants take in carbon dioxide (co 2) and water (h 2 o) from the air and soil.
